Abstract

A cyclone flash drying apparatus is provided. The cyclone flash drying apparatus is provided with an air filter, an air dehumidifier, an air blower, an air heater, a screw feeder, a drying host machine, an impact type cyclone drying tower, a cyclone separator, a dust collector and an induced draft fan; high-temperature and low-humidity air outputted by the air blower is divided into two paths, wherein one path is led to the air heater, and the other path is led to a Du kang cone on a discharge port of the cyclone separator; hot airflow outputted by the air heater is divided into two paths, wherein one path is led to an air inlet of the drying host machine, and the other path is led to an air inlet of the impact type cyclone drying tower; an upper portion of the interior of the cylinder body of the drying host machine is provided with a dynamic flow stabilizing ring; a lower portion of the interior of the cylinder body of the drying host machine is provided with a lifting stirrer; an upper layer impact type cyclone ring and a lower layer impact type cyclone ring are fixed on the inner wall of the impact type cyclone drying tower; and the screw feeder extends into the drying host machine, and a discharge port of the screw feeder is located above the lifting stirrer. The cyclone flash drying apparatus of the utility model can improve the rate collection of finished products and is suitable for drying products with high sugar and fat contents.

Background technology
The drying medium of expansion drying generally adopts surrounding air, surrounding air is after air cleaner, by blower fan, blast in vapor heat exchanger, fire coal or fuel oil or fuel gas hot-blast stove and be heated, hot blast after heating is again through flash distillation main frame hot-air distributor, is distributed into evenly, the whirlwind of certain flow rate, the flow direction.The wet stock that whirlwind adds with screw feeder contacts, collides, and starts a series of physical changes such as matter heat exchange, separation, makes material separated with contained wet part, reaches eventually dry.China Patent No. is that 92242824.7 utility model patent description discloses a kind of spiral-flow flashing drier, comprise dry cavity and cyclone separator, heater is connected with distributor, top at distributor is provided with dispenser, the other end of distributor communicates with the suction side of centrifugal type air-heater, the other end of centrifugal type air-heater communicates with dry cavity bottom, at dry cavity bottom, there is a taper discharging to crouch, dry cavity top communicates with cyclone separator, one discharge gate is arranged at cyclone separator bottom, and cyclone separator top communicates with deduster.To sugary in the industries such as medicine, biochemical industry, food, containing grease compared with in the production drying process of high product, the feature such as water translocation is slow because material heat resisting temperature is low, in dry run, dry above-mentioned material in common spiral-flow flashing drier, that the material often existing is difficult for is dry, the easy shortcoming such as softening or coking of product, and finished product collection rate is lower.

The utlity model has following good effect: 1, the utility model is low for the dry rear temperature of outgoing air of heat sensitive material, relative humidity requires high feature, be provided with air dehumidifier, to dry and coolingly frontly carry out reducing temperature and humidity with air, can guarantee the relative humidity of dry rear exhaust air with lower temperature, thereby assurance product quality, improves finished product collection rate.2, the utility model has certain viscosity for sugary material, screw feeder discharging opening is deeply coordinated to elevate a turnable ladder formula agitator in dry king-tower center, make material rapid dispersion and be promoted to rapid draing district, avoid material dispersion not exclusively to fall into mixing chamber and produce ruckbildung, favourable raising finished product collection rate.3, increase the dry king-tower inner air of dynamic current stabilization ring balance in main drying of the present utility model and distribute, avoid air turbulization and affect drying effect, same favourable raising finished product collection rate.4, the utility model increases impact type cyclone drying tower, in impact type cyclone drying tower, be provided with impact type whirlwind ring, this whirlwind ring can make hot blast produce just as pulse air streaming drying effect, hot blast can fully be contacted with material, promote hot blast and material to carry out heat exchanging tampering process, thereby increase drying time, make material have enough drying times, guarantee that the moisture that material is difficult for moving out is dried.Impact type cyclone drying tower is introduced the new wind of one high temperature low humidity and is mixed with dry high humidity hot blast, can effectively prevent that material redrying is insufficient, can further improve finished product collection rate.5, one low temperature and low humidity fresh air of the wine on cyclone separator discharging opening top cone introducing carries out cooling discharging by finished product materials, prevents that material from producing hygroscopic effect when high temperature, guarantees that packing is temperature required simultaneously.
